Dévotion de Galloi
12 XP
With a drizzle of blood on a subject’s brow, the Pretty can change the way that mirrors, cameras and other reflective media capture that individual’s visage. When seen in a mirror, photograph or onscreen from any kind of camera, a mortal’s form appears blurry or warped; her face is especially disturbed. Vampires, on the other hand, experience the opposite effect. They no longer show up obscured in mirrors or upon photographic media and, in fact, appear quite crisply.
Cost: 1 Vitae (must be sprinkled upon subject)
Dice Pool: Manipulation + Stealth + Obfuscate versus subject’s Composure + Blood Potency (if subject is unwilling)
Action: Contested; instant if subject is willing.
On a successful roll, the described effects take place. Mortals become obfuscated in mirrors and photographic media, whereas Kindred now show up in mirrors and photographic media. An exceptional success allows a +1 bonus to Stealth rolls (for mortals) and a +1 bonus to Persuasion rolls (for vampires). Failure indicates nothing happens, and a dramatic failure causes the sprinkled blood to burn the subject with one lethal point of damage.
The effects of this power last for a number of nights equal to the Galloi’s Blood Potency score. The Pretty may end this power prematurely by spending a Will- power point.
